From aea7ef58b625b09fdac3dd6800592594a17e5035 Mon Sep 17 00:00:00 2001 From: veg Date: Sat, 11 Jul 2026 12:48:29 +0000 Subject: [PATCH] feat: party log records a group-readable transcript tmux pipe-pane on every pane of the party session, appending into /log (0640, party group) so any attendee can grab a copy. Start and stop are announced to everyone attached; close rescues a non-empty transcript to the host's home before removing the dir. Panes opened later are picked up by re-running party log (a pane_pipe check keeps already-piped panes single-piped, since tmux's pipe-pane -o toggles an existing pipe closed rather than skipping it). Raw output, escapes included. Close polls the transcript for size stability before rescuing it, since a cross-filesystem mv is copy+unlink and could otherwise drop bytes still draining from the pipe-pane writers. --- README.md | 2 + ROADMAP.md | 7 --- party | 109 ++++++++++++++++++++++++++++++++++++++++++++++ party.1 | 31 +++++++++++++ tests/87-log.bats | 87 ++++++++++++++++++++++++++++++++++++ 5 files changed, 229 insertions(+), 7 deletions(-) create mode 100644 tests/87-log.bats diff --git a/README.md b/README.md index c512486..7a58b8b 100644 --- a/README.md +++ b/README.md @@ -100,6 +100,7 @@ Three honest caveats, with the full detail in `man party`: - On ACL-enabled filesystems (ZFS, HFS+/APFS), inherited ACLs can override the mode bits, so the FS gate is best-effort.
